Oracle July 2010 Security Update Multiple Vulnerabilities
SEVERITY: Urgent Urgent-5 5
QUALYS ID: 19565
VENDOR REFERENCE: CPUJUL2010
CVE REFERENCE: CVE-2010-0911 | CVE-2010-0903 | CVE-2010-0902 | CVE-2010-0892 | CVE-2010-0900 | CVE-2010-0901
CVSS SCORES: Base 7.8/ Temporal 5.8
THREAT: Oracle released a Critical Patch Update advisory for July 2010 that addresses several security vulnerabilities.

The following Oracle database components are affected:
* Application Express
* Export
* Listener
* Net Foundation Layer
* Network Layer
* Oracle OLAP

IMPACT: Successful exploitation allows an attacker to execute arbitrary code and conduct privilege escalation attacks.
SOLUTION: Oracle recommends that customers upgrade to the latest supported version of Oracle products in order to obtain the patches. Read Oracle Critical Patch Update Advisory - JULY 2010 for further information about the products affected and issues addressed.
